Digital Trichoscopy with AI Analysis
Traditional scalp examinations relied heavily on the naked eye, making it difficult to detect early changes or subtle patterns. Today’s digital trichoscopy has revolutionized this process:
“High-definition trichoscopes magnify the scalp up to 200x, revealing details invisible to the human eye alone,” our specialist explains. “When combined with AI analysis, these images provide unprecedented insights into hair and scalp health.”
These advanced systems offer several game-changing capabilities:
- Pattern recognition algorithms that identify specific conditions from visual markers
- Comparative analysis tracking subtle changes over time
- Follicular unit counting providing precise density measurements
- Vascular assessment evaluating blood flow patterns essential for growth
- Early detection of miniaturization and other changes before visible hair loss occurs
“The difference between treating based on general assumptions versus treating based on digital trichoscopy findings is profound,” notes our specialist. “It’s like the difference between navigating with general directions versus using GPS with real-time traffic updates.”

Exosome Therapy: The Frontier of Hair Regeneration
Exosomes—tiny extracellular vesicles that facilitate cell-to-cell communication—represent one of the most promising frontiers in hair treatment technology:
“Exosomes derived from stem cells contain powerful growth factors, proteins, and genetic material that can significantly influence hair follicle behavior,” our specialist explains. “They essentially deliver regenerative instructions to follicle cells.”
The technology behind therapeutic exosomes includes:
- Isolation techniques that harvest specific exosome types
- Purification systems ensuring optimal concentration and purity
- Delivery mechanisms that enhance penetration to follicle depth
- Stabilization technology maintaining exosome integrity until application
- Targeted formulations addressing specific hair and scalp concerns
Early research shows remarkable potential for treating pattern hair loss, inflammatory scalp conditions, and even some forms of scarring alopecia previously considered untreatable.
Advanced Light Therapy Systems
Light-based treatments have evolved dramatically from early laser combs to sophisticated multi-wavelength systems:
“Today’s advanced photobiomodulation devices deliver precise light wavelengths that trigger specific cellular responses in hair follicles,” our trichologist explains. “These responses include increased energy production, enhanced blood flow, and optimized cellular function.”
Cutting-edge light therapy technologies include:
- Multi-wavelength systems targeting different cellular mechanisms simultaneously
- Pulsed light technology optimizing cellular response while preventing adaptation
- LED arrays providing uniform coverage across the entire scalp
- Programmable protocols customized to specific conditions and treatment phases
- Combination therapy integration enhancing results when used with other treatments
Research shows these advanced systems can increase hair count, improve shaft diameter, extend the growth phase of hair cycles, and enhance overall scalp health when used appropriately.

Electroporation Technology
This sophisticated approach temporarily increases cellular permeability:
“Electroporation uses controlled electrical pulses to temporarily open channels in cell membranes, allowing treatments to enter more effectively,” our trichologist explains. “This can significantly enhance the penetration of molecular treatments to their cellular targets.”
Modern systems feature:
- Precisely calibrated electrical parameters ensuring safety and efficacy
- Integrated delivery mechanisms timing treatment application with pulse delivery
- Sequential programming optimizing the treatment process
- Comfort management features making the experience pleasant
- Monitoring systems assessing tissue response during treatment
When used with appropriate therapeutic compounds, electroporation can enhance effectiveness while reducing the concentration needed for results.
